Why is Indian Hotels Co falling/rising?

As of 26-Jun, Indian Hotels Co Ltd is priced at 781.00, down 0.2%, but has shown a strong weekly return of 4.41% and is trading above key moving averages, indicating a positive trend. Despite a year-to-date decline of 10.89%, the stock has strong institutional support and robust financial health, suggesting it remains a strong market contender.
As of 26-Jun, Indian Hotels Co Ltd is currently priced at 781.00, reflecting a decrease of 1.6 or 0.2%. Despite this decline, the stock has shown a strong performance over the past week, with a return of 4.41%, and has outperformed the benchmark Sensex, which increased by 2.94% during the same period. The stock has recently experienced a trend reversal, falling after four consecutive days of gains. It is noteworthy that Indian Hotels Co is trading above its 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day moving averages, indicating a generally positive trend. Additionally, there has been a significant increase in investor participation, with delivery volume rising by 47.27% against the 5-day average, suggesting strong interest in the stock. The company has demonstrated robust financial health, with a low Debt to EBITDA ratio and consistent positive results over the last 14 quarters, contributing to its long-term growth outlook.

In the broader market context, while Indian Hotels Co has underperformed its sector by 0.36% today, its year-to-date performance shows a decline of 10.89%, contrasting with the Sensex's gain of 7.19%. However, the stock has delivered impressive returns over the past three years, outperforming the BSE 500 consistently. The company's high institutional holdings at 46.15% indicate confidence from larger investors who are better equipped to analyze the company's fundamentals. Despite the recent price drop, the overall financial indicators and consistent returns suggest that the stock remains a strong contender in the market, with a significant market cap that constitutes a large portion of the sector.
